Vertical Shaft Impactor Tubular Metal Rotor offers higher tip speeds and lower maintenance costs
Patented VSI Tubular Rotor creates higher tip-speeds, which increases first pass yield, yields tighter particle size distribution and reduces recirculation loads. The rotor rotation is reversible, allowing wear on both sides of the tube. Rotating the indexing tube one-quarter turn quadruples the wear surfaces. The Tubular Rotor and Reversible Anvils can be retrofitted to any brand VSI.
Applications include Limestone, Sand & Gravel, Glass, Ferro Silicon & Silicon Carbide, Aluminum Dross & Other Slags, Burnt Magnesite, Tungsten Carbide, Trona Sulfate, Barite, Bakery Waste, Zeolite and many more. Raw feed sizes up to 5". Models up to 500 TPH available. Capacities vary depending on feed size, feed rate, operating conditions, desired product output, characteristics of feed material, and equipment configuration.
